I know you have Pain Attunement on your Skin of the Lords (which is excellent) but it does nothing for you because you are not a low life build. Once we use the belt (and associated Watchers Eye), we can then allocate the Pain Attunement passive on the tree for a MASSIVE dps boost. The build uses the Cowards Legacy belt to trick the game into thinking we are low life.
